The Power of Amino Acid Surfactants in Modern Cosmetics
In the ever-evolving landscape of cosmetic science, the demand for effective yet gentle ingredients has never been higher. Consumers are increasingly seeking products that not only perform well but are also kind to their skin and the environment. This shift has propelled the rise of amino acid surfactants, a class of compounds offering a remarkable blend of efficacy and sustainability. Among these, N-Lauroyl-L-Glutamic Acid stands out as a prime example of innovation in personal care ingredients.
N-Lauroyl-L-Glutamic Acid, identified by its CAS number 3397-65-7, is synthesized from naturally occurring amino acids. This derivation gives it inherent biocompatibility and a gentle profile, making it an ideal component for sensitive skin formulations. Unlike some traditional surfactants that can strip the skin of its natural oils, leading to dryness and irritation, amino acid surfactants like N-Lauroyl-L-Glutamic Acid are known for their mild cleansing action. They effectively remove impurities and excess sebum while preserving the skin's moisture barrier, contributing to a soft and supple feel.
The versatility of N-Lauroyl-L-Glutamic Acid extends to its excellent emulsifying and conditioning properties. In skincare, this translates to formulations that are smooth, stable, and provide a luxurious feel. In haircare, it contributes to improved manageability, softness, and shine, making it a valuable ingredient in shampoos, conditioners, and styling products. The compound's ability to create rich, creamy lather further enhances the user experience, a critical factor in consumer satisfaction.
Beyond performance, the environmental profile of N-Lauroyl-L-Glutamic Acid is a significant advantage. As a biodegradable personal care ingredient, it aligns with the industry's move towards greener chemistry and sustainable sourcing. This biodegradability means that once the product is used, it breaks down naturally, minimizing its impact on aquatic ecosystems. For manufacturers committed to sustainability, incorporating such ingredients is a strategic imperative.
Furthermore, N-Lauroyl-L-Glutamic Acid is recognized for its potential as a pharmaceutical intermediate, particularly in topical applications where mildness and efficacy are paramount. Its low toxicity profile makes it suitable for inclusion in dermatological treatments and other sensitive medicinal formulations. The increasing interest in naturally derived compounds within the pharmaceutical sector may further drive its adoption in this field.
